    Quote Originally Posted by shubox88:

    Vanzack, since you have 45k+ posts @ Covers in the past decade, what has been the biggest change about the site that you have noticed during that time frame? 

    I love this question.  Made me really think.

    When this site first started, there was one forum room (Lou's Hot Tub) and maybe 10 posts a day.  I was just so amazed and excited to find that there were actually other people who gambled in the world.  I was a corporate guy who was very soiltary with my gambling, but now I could post messages about who I liked and gambling theory with other closet gamblers?  Nirvana had arrived.

    A couple of years after I found covers, the gambling climate was at its alltime best.  Mansion, Pinnacle, Neteller - they were all there.  I could see a line I wanted to bet, and within 5 minutes have a neteller withdrawal from one book, and a transfer to the target book, and have 25k on a line that I loved.  I was transferring money in and out of my bank account to neteller in ridiculous frequency.  Those were the days.  Not because it was fun or it was convenient - but BECAUSE IT MADE ME MORE PROFITABLE.

    Fast forward to today, and the gambling climate is the worst it has ever been.  But covers?  Covers is busier than ever.  I think it is no secret that covers has emerged as a recreational gamblers paradise, and there are always going to be people willing to lay -110 and lose money for entertainment, and they need a place to go.  I guess I am attracted to this place because those kind of people are generally more entertaining than brainiac statisticians, and I generally use covers for entertainment.  Where else can you post something and have 50 responses in 10 minutes?  If there is any action I am addicted to, it is the action at covers - sometimes I hit refresh on a hot thread so many times I think my computer will start smoking.

    Quote Originally Posted by The Giant:

    Vanzack, I know you've been a big advocate for Matchbook over the years, but what's going on with them recently? I tried to deposit some money with them last week, and they told me the only way they were accepting deposits these days was through interbook transfers.

    No online banking, no wire transfers, etc.

    They told me things might improve in the future, but, yeah, this doesn't sound good.

    Have any insight?

    Answered this earlier because of the MB closing last night to Americans.....  But one more thought....

    I think (and this is only opinion) that you will see a new exchange rise up for Americans to fill the void.  It might take several years, but we have seen that things happen fast in the offshore world, so keep your eyes open.  It is the future - the only future I see - for sportsbetting.

    As for me - I think it would take a miracle for me NOT to skip MLB this season.  I cant lay -108 at pinny and make money over the whole season.  My margins are razor tight, and that was with MB.

    Quote Originally Posted by Getty3:

    How important do you feel watching a team's form first hand is before betting them ? Or do you feel that paper stats can tell the story well enough without using the eye test ?

    Getty - my method is to come up with a "gut line" and a "stats line".  The stats line is blind to anything but paper stats, but the gut line is what I come up with - so it is imperative that I watch.  There are times that my gut line is less important than my stats line, but there are other times where my gut line is what is driving me.

    For instance - the World Cup this past summer was all gut.  There are no stats to go on other than surface stuff that would mean nothing in a computer analysis.  So watching was very important.  But do I watch every baseball game during a season?  Not at all, in fact MLB is proably the least important to watch - and many nights I go to bed not knowing a single result until the AM only to find out if I won or lost the night before.  MLB is a stats driven game - and even my gut line is determined a lot by my stats bias in my head.
